Output c14162890c099aa32f748169323a0cfa31ecf4024be4e9de22e000f6ebf0dda7:40

value
30896645
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ddd186215d62a17bdae33f831bbe4a21e3001c2a OP_EQUALVERIFY OP_CHECKSIG
address
1MDsLNfdNa4uaQqP1tVyd3AKSWaeH8aLyS
transaction
c14162890c099aa32f748169323a0cfa31ecf4024be4e9de22e000f6ebf0dda7
spent
true